First Stop: South Mountain Reservation

If you're looking for a breath of fresh air on your road trip, your first stop should be South Mountain Reservation. This park offers plenty of opportunities for hiking, biking, and picnicking. You can even bring your furry friends along for the ride, as the park is dog-friendly.

Make sure you visit the Hemlock Falls, a hidden gem located in the middle of the reservation. This 25-foot waterfall is surrounded by lush green vegetation, and it's the perfect spot for a photo op. At the top of the falls, you'll find a tranquil pool where you can take a dip on a hot day.

Second Stop: Thomas Edison's House

As you continue on your road trip, make sure you take a detour to West Orange to visit Thomas Edison's House. This National Historic Site offers a glimpse into the life of one of America's most notable inventors.

Edison's house has been beautifully preserved, and you can see the intricate details of his life, from his bedroom to his laboratory. The museum offers guided tours, and the knowledgeable staff will share stories about Edison's life and work.

Fourth Stop: Cheesequake State Park

While you might be tempted to drive straight through Old Bridge, make sure you take a break at Cheesequake State Park. This park offers several trails for hiking and biking, as well as fishing and boating opportunities.

You can also explore the Marsh Trail, which winds through the wetlands and offers a chance to see a variety of birds and other wildlife. If you're traveling with kids, they'll love the playgrounds and picnic areas, which offer a chance to unwind and relax during your road trip.

Fifth Stop: Old Bridge Waterfront Park

Your final stop on your road trip should be the Old Bridge Waterfront Park. This park offers stunning views of the Raritan Bay and the New York skyline, and it's the perfect place to admire the beauty of New Jersey.

The park also offers several walking trails, a fishing pier, and a playground for kids. You can even rent kayaks and paddleboards if you want to explore the bay. Make sure you stay until sunset to witness one of the most spectacular views of the New York skyline.
